db文件如何修复?专业修复步骤与注意事项

时间: 2026-07-04
编辑: USTAT.COM

在日常办公与系统运维中,db文件作为数据库的核心存储载体,承载着大量关键数据,一旦出现损坏、无法读取等问题,可能会影响业务正常运转,甚至造成不可逆的数据损失。很多用户遇到db文件异常时往往束手无策,不知道该从何入手修复。本文将从db文件损坏的原因入手,逐步讲解专业的修复步骤,同时梳理关键注意事项,帮助用户高效解决db文件相关问题,守护数据安全。

db文件

一、db文件损坏的常见诱因有哪些?

想要高效修复db文件,首先要明确其损坏的根源,这样才能做到对症下药,避免后续再次出现类似问题。

1、异常断电或强制关机

这是db文件损坏的最常见原因之一,当系统正在读写db文件时,突然断电或强制关闭设备,会导致db文件的写入操作中断,数据结构出现混乱,部分数据块丢失或错位,最终引发db文件无法正常打开。

2、存储介质故障

如果db文件存储在机械硬盘、U盘等介质上,当介质出现坏道、磁头损坏等硬件问题时,会直接影响db文件的完整性,导致部分数据无法被正常读取,表现为db文件打开报错或内容缺失。

3、软件冲突或病毒攻击

运行中的数据库软件若与其他程序发生冲突,可能会干扰db文件的正常读写逻辑;而病毒、恶意软件则可能直接篡改db文件的内容或破坏其数据结构,造成db文件损坏。

 

二、db文件手动修复的专业操作步骤

对于部分轻度损坏的db文件,用户可以通过手动操作进行修复,这种方式无需借助第三方工具,操作成本较低。

1、备份原始db文件

在进行任何修复操作前,务必先复制一份原始db文件到其他安全存储介质中,避免修复过程中操作失误,导致原始db文件的损坏程度加重,彻底失去恢复数据的可能。备份完成后,再对副本进行修复操作。

2、利用数据库自带工具修复

主流的数据库软件大多自带修复工具,比如SQLite的sqlite3.exe工具,用户可以通过命令行窗口执行修复指令,先对损坏的db文件进行完整性检测,再根据检测结果执行修复命令,重建db文件的索引和数据结构,使其恢复正常读取能力。

 

三、第三方工具修复db文件的实用方案

当db文件损坏程度较严重,手动修复无法解决问题时,借助专业的第三方修复工具是更高效的选择。

1、选择正规可靠的修复工具

市面上的db文件修复工具种类繁多,用户要优先选择口碑好、官方认证的工具,避免使用来源不明的软件,防止修复过程中出现数据泄露或二次损坏的问题。比如Stellar Repair for SQLite、DBF Repair Tool等,都是针对db文件修复的专业工具。

2、按照工具指引完成修复

下载安装正规工具后,先添加损坏的db文件,工具会自动对db文件进行扫描检测,识别损坏的具体位置和类型,随后用户可以根据工具提示选择修复模式,等待修复完成后,将修复后的db文件导出到指定路径,再验证其可用性。

 

四、db文件修复后的验证与防护要点

完成db文件修复后,不能直接投入使用,还需要进行全面验证,同时做好日常防护,避免db文件再次出现损坏。

1、修复后db文件的完整性验证

将修复后的db文件导入对应数据库软件,检查是否能正常打开,逐一查看关键数据表的内容是否完整,执行简单的查询、修改操作,确认db文件的读写功能是否恢复正常,若发现仍有异常,需重新进行修复操作。

2、日常防护避免db文件再次损坏

要养成定期备份db文件的习惯,设置自动备份任务,将备份文件存储在不同的介质中;同时避免在读写db文件时强制关机,定期对存储介质进行检测维护,安装正规的杀毒软件,从源头降低db文件损坏的概率。

 

综上所述,db文件修复需要从明确损坏原因入手,根据损坏程度选择手动修复或第三方工具修复的方式,修复完成后还要做好验证与日常防护。掌握这些专业方法,就能在遇到db文件损坏问题时从容应对,有效降低数据丢失风险,保障db文件承载的关键数据安全,为业务正常运转提供有力支撑。